1
A
回答
6
全部String
文字进入字符串池。否则,你的应用程序必须调用intern()
在String
,否则将无法进入游泳池。
String
一个文字是出现在源代码用双引号它周围的字符串:
String greeting = "Hello, ";
String s = greeting + name;
在这个例子中,"Hello, "
是字符串。它在实习生池中。它也被变量greeting
引用。
s
所指的String
不是字面意思,也不在实习生池中......除非你打这个电话:
s = s.intern();
+0
嗨埃里克森,有见地,我是否可以说实习生池==字符串池? –
+0
@ChinBoon是的,运行时使用的唯一'String'池是intern池。 – erickson
相关问题
- 1. 为什么字符串存储在Java中的字符串池?
- 2. 在字符串中存储字符串
- 3. 字符串唯一字符
- 4. 在字符串内存储字符串?
- 5. 在kdb中存储一个字符串作为字符串
- 6. 字符串池(字符串和StringBuffer)
- 7. 存储字符串
- 8. 存储字符串
- 9. 存储字符串
- 10. 分割字符串并存储在一个新的字符串
- 11. 如何在Java中存储唯一的字符串对?
- 12. 在一个字符串变量中存储一个字符
- 13. 存储字符串中有
- 14. 存储在字符串
- 15. 字符串池8
- 16. 使用Strtok存储一串字符串
- 17. 将字符串的地址存储在字符串数组中
- 18. 如何在字符串标签中存储字符串
- 19. 在二维字符串数组中存储很多字符串
- 20. 将部分字符串存储在字符串数组中
- 21. 在数组中存储字符串并拆分字符串
- 22. 字符串的子串和存储在字符中
- 23. 在旧字符串和新字符串中存储随机数
- 24. 字符串内存分配和字符串池概念
- 25. Understading字符串文字池
- 26. 字符串文字池
- 27. Rails字符串唯一ID
- 28. 唯一字符串组合
- 29. 字符串中的唯一字
- 30. 计算字符串中的唯一字
_new_字符串文字? – Bwmat
而且那些串x = “ZZZ”; –
@Chin。 'String x =“zzz”'不会创建一个新的字符串对象。 –